I will define further stock market terminology here. Before we head off in quest of our pot-o-gold

(and please believe me it is out there, in penny stock land) we'll touch on the buzz words of trading.

*What is EBIDTA?- is a company's earnings before interest, taxes and amortization write downs. In effect, this is a company's gross earnings.

*What is Net Income Applicable to Common Shares?-this is the bottom line profit that a company reports that belongs to the common shareholders (Owners)

*Define Diluted Earnings Per Share-is a company's earnings per share calculated using fully diluted shares outstanding, including convertible bonds and stock options. In effect, a "worst case scenario".

*What is Current Ratio?-a financial ratio that measures whether or not a firm has enough resources to pay it's debt, over the next 12 months. In effect for every dollar of debt, what ratio can their assets cover.


*Define Book Value-somewhat similar to earnings per share, book value relates to stockholder equity to the number of outstanding shares, giving the shares a raw value.

*What is a Short Sale?- this is a technique used by investors to take advantage of a stocks falling price. These shares are borrowed from a broker, with the intent of selling and hopefully to be bought back later, at a lower price.

*What is Float- these shares represent freely tradeable shares. Those shares that are not held by insiders or institutions. The smaller the float, the more volatile the stock can be.
